NOVELTY - Preparing polyanion sodium ion battery electrode, comprises preparing precursor, adding graphene oxide or modified graphene into precursor, preparing polyanionic compounds, and preparing polyanion sodium ion battery electrode. USE - The method is useful for preparing polyanion sodium ion battery electrode. ADVANTAGE - The method enables to prepare polyanion sodium ion battery electrode, which has excellent ionic conductivity, electron conductivity and conductivity. The polyanionic polymer containing zirconium-aluminum has excellent dynamics performance. The ratio and long cycle performance of the poly anionic polymer is improved to prolong the cycle life of the material, and has improved specific surface area and ionic high speed channel, and improved sodium storage performance of poly anion compound. The method is simple and cost-effective, and provides electrode with excellent performance and stability.
